  • the invention relates to an under shower with the features of the preamble of claim 1.
  • the invention is directed in particular to an under shower as an additional module for a conventional toilet that does not have a shower function.
  • shower toilets known from the market have an integrated shower function for the anal and / or genital area of the user.
  • a nozzle is arranged at the end of the shower device, through which the water exits in the direction of the area to be cleaned.
  • the nozzle can usually be extended, either electromechanically or under water pressure. In the latter case, the water pressure is used to feed the nozzle.
  • the shower facility is controlled by a valve that opens and closes the water supply.
  • the operation can for example be done manually - that is, by opening the valve - or electromechanically, with the electromechanical control triggering a pulse that causes the valve to open or close.
  • the flow rate can often be regulated.
  • shower toilets with an integral under-shower are highly developed toilets which, depending on the equipment, have additional functions such as drying function, heating function of the toilet seat and the like. Such shower toilets have basically proven their worth. However, their complexity makes them very expensive.
  • the invention is particularly directed to shower devices of this type.
  • a shower device that can be retrofitted as an additional module to a conventional toilet.
  • the known shower device has a fastening device with two recesses.
  • the threaded rods of the toilet seat hinge for fastening the toilet seat to the toilet bowl reach through the two recesses.
  • the shower device is therefore clamped between the toilet seat and the basin for attachment.
  • the known shower facility allows cost-effective retrofitting of conventional toilets. A separate water connection is all that is required for the shower function.
  • the well-known shower facility is quite high. As a result, the rear of the toilet seat is also increases, so that there is a risk that the rear section of the toilet seat will no longer rest on the toilet bowl. In addition to loss of appearance, there is a risk that the toilet seat and / or shower facility will be overloaded.
  • the invention is based on the basic idea that a particularly flat construction can preferably be created in that the line runs at least partially behind the cutouts in the fastening device. Only the feed line to the nozzle - which in turn is preferably arranged in front of the fastening device - is routed to the front between the cutouts. This line section can be kept flat for technical reasons, in particular when it is a hose-like line, as is considered preferred.
  • the attachment of the under shower to the toilet bowl is of particular importance. It must be flat on the one hand and stable on the other.
  • a particularly advantageous embodiment is characterized in that the fastening device has two fastening straps.
  • the fastening straps offer the possibility of being clamped between the hinge (for fastening the toilet seat to the basin) and the basin.
  • hinge pins of hinges reach through the respective recess, which can be open or closed, in particular designed as an elongated hole.
  • the fastening tabs are designed in such a way that their distance from one another can be changed. This ensures adaptability to different attachments of toilet seats and / or toilet bowls. At their rear end, the fastening tabs can be conveniently connected to a housing of the shower device, as will be explained in more detail below. In principle, a large number of materials are conceivable for the fastening device, including plastic.
  • a fastening device made of metal has proven particularly useful. It particularly fulfills the requirement for stability with minimal space requirements at the same time.
  • the fastening device preferably comprises two separate fastening tabs, each of which advantageously has a recess. The advantage of an independent arrangement of the fastening tabs lies beyond the above-described advantage of adaptability in that between the There is enough space for the fastening tabs to lead the cable between the two recesses to the front.
  • the fastening device advantageously has a maximum height of 10 mm, in particular a maximum of 3 mm, at least in the region of the cutouts. If the fastening device is made of metal, sufficient stability is also given if the fastening device is made significantly thinner than 10 mm, in particular thinner than 3 mm, for example approx. 1 mm.
  • the under shower has a housing with preferably an underside and an upper side.
  • the line is advantageously guided in the housing.
  • the housing protects the components received in the housing and allows their inspection when the top and bottom are detachably connected to one another, as is considered advantageous.
  • the fastening tabs expediently extend from the housing, advantageously to the front.
  • the housing is preferably arranged behind the fastening tabs (or generally the fastening device). This means that, in the assembled state, the housing can be arranged behind the toilet seat, which does not rule out that it also extends laterally to the front of the toilet seat, as will be explained in more detail below.
  • the fastening device is suspended in the housing, in particular in the underside, and can be displaced relative to the housing.
  • the under shower can be attached to different (predefined) openings in the toilet bowl for the toilet seat fixings can be adjusted.
  • the underside preferably has a grid that interacts with the fastening device. The grid also prevents the installed under shower from slipping sideways.
  • the fastening device is advantageously clamped between the top and the bottom of the housing. Such a construction allows the fastening device to be easily fixed to the housing and also ensures simple adjustability.
  • safety fittings In some countries, safety fittings must be installed at endangered water intake points. An under-shower is also one of the endangered areas. The safety fittings ensure that endangered tapping points are protected from non-potable water being sucked back, pushed back or flowed back.
  • a water protection device is arranged in the housing of the under shower.
  • the water protection can in particular be a free outlet with an injector.
  • a jet of water is sprayed over a free space into a receptacle, which can be funnel-like.
  • the injector it is possible to achieve a required minimum pressure that is required to move or extend the nozzle from its rest position into the working position against a restoring force.
  • the underside of the housing forms a channel for the leakage.
  • the underside thus preferably takes on two tasks, namely, on the one hand, fastening the water protection and, on the other hand, draining the leakage into the toilet. Additionally or alternatively it can be provided that the feed line of the nozzle is arranged in the channel.
  • the water protection is arranged behind the cutouts and the underside extends forward between the two cutouts. Since the water protection has a certain height due to the design, it is arranged behind the recesses in the advantageous embodiment, with the result that it is located behind the toilet seat in the installed state.
  • the channel on the other hand, can be kept flat and guided forward between the recesses. This measure advantageously means that there is no need to increase the (existing) toilet seat.
  • a particularly advantageous construction is characterized in that the nozzle is arranged at a free end of the underside of the housing.
  • the nozzle can be attached to the underside. It is considered to be particularly advantageous if the nozzle can be extended by the water pressure, specifically preferably downwards (in the installed state), in particular essentially vertically downwards.
  • the nozzle itself has a spray angle that is directed upwards.
  • the top of the housing preferably covers the channel.
  • the top also covers the nozzle.
  • the upper side expediently forms a downwardly directed cover in its end region. If necessary, the nozzle extends downwards beyond the cover.
  • the invention is also directed to a toilet with an under shower.
  • the toilet has a toilet seat, the attachment of which to the toilet bowl also provides the attachment of the under-shower.
  • the fastening device is advantageously secured to the toilet bowl of the toilet with that fastening with which the toilet seat on the toilet bowl is also fastened to the toilet bowl.
  • the fastening can be, for example, two hinges or hinge pins.
  • a core idea of the invention is that the shower head does not form a hinge for the toilet seat.
  • FIG. 1 shows a shower device according to the invention in a perspective view.
  • the shower device consists of three essential components, namely a valve 1, a water safety device 2 and a nozzle 3.
  • the valve 1 and the water safety device 2 are connected to one another via a line 4. The same applies to water protection 2 and nozzle 3.
  • the valve 1 is via a rotary knob 5 (see Figure 2 ) operable and connected via a rear connection 6 to a water pipe, not shown. If the user turns on the valve 1, water passes through the line section 4, the water protection 2, the subsequent line section 4 and emerges from the nozzle 3.
  • the nozzle 1 is designed in such a way that it extends against a restoring force, specifically in the direction of the arrow P1 vertically downwards. The water reaches the area of the user to be cleaned through the nozzle 3.
  • the water protection 2 is preferably a protection according to DIN EN1717, which in particular has a free outlet with an injector. Any leakage is diverted to the outside through openings 7 of the water protection 2.
  • the valve 1, the water protection 2 and the nozzle 3 are preferably fixed to a lower part 8 of a housing 9 (see FIG. 2).
  • the lower part 8 forms a channel 10, through which the leakage can drain into a toilet bowl.
  • the channel 10 serves to accommodate the line 4.
  • the under shower is fixed to the toilet bowl via a fastening device which, in the preferred embodiment shown, consists of two tabs 11, 12, which are preferably made of metal, which allows a particularly flat and at the same time stable and durable construction.
  • the tabs 11, 12 each have a hole 13, which is preferably designed as an elongated hole and through which a hinge of the toilet seat engages, as it is in connection with Figure 4 is described in more detail.
  • a one-piece fastening device can be provided.
  • the fastening tabs 11, 12 are suspended in the underside 8 of the housing 9 and preferably can be moved independently of one another relative to the housing 9 for their adjustment.
  • the underside 8 has a grid 14 which interacts with the respective tab 11, 12.
  • the grid 14 provides additional support for the tabs 11, 12 and prevents the shower device from unintentionally slipping sideways.
  • FIG. 2 shows the under shower with the housing 9 closed.
  • a top 15 is clipped, glued or screwed onto the underside 8 of the housing. Thanks to the housing, the under shower is dust-proof and easy to clean.
  • the housing 9 With its upper side 15, the housing 9 forms an arm 16 which extends forward between the tabs 11, 12 and preferably a downwardly extending one in its end region Cover 17 forms.
  • the cover 17 protects the nozzle 3 from soiling in its rest position. Only when the actuating button 5 is actuated does the nozzle 3 move under water pressure from its rest position into the working position downwards, so that it emerges from under the cover and can freely emit the water jet.
  • FIG 3 shows the under-shower on a toilet bowl 18.
  • the toilet bowl 18 has two openings 19 through which two (in Figure 4 the hinges 20 shown).
  • hinges can also be designed in several parts.
  • they can have a hinge pin and a hinge attachment detachably connected to it.
  • Such multi-part hinges are intended to be encompassed by the term hinge.
  • the under-shower can be adapted to the shape of the toilet bowl 18 and / or the toilet seat via the elongated hole 13.
  • FIG. 5 shows a toilet equipped with an under-shower according to the invention with a toilet seat 21.
  • the under-shower according to the invention particularly advantageously does not have any noteworthy features Raising the toilet seat 21 instead. This is achieved in that only the thin fastening tabs 11, 12, preferably made of metal, are clamped between the toilet seat 21 and the toilet bowl 18.
  • the higher structures such as the water protection 2 are arranged behind the toilet seat 21.
